Low sperm count, or oligospermia, is a condition characterized by a lower-than-normal number of sperm in the ejaculate, which can impact fertility and reduce the likelihood of conception. This condition is typically defined as having fewer than 15 million sperm per milliliter of semen. Causes of low sperm count can be diverse and include hormonal imbalances, genetic factors, and lifestyle influences. Medical conditions such as diabetes, infections, or varicoceles (enlarged veins in the scrotum) can also contribute to reduced sperm production. Additionally, environmental factors like exposure to toxins, radiation, or excessive heat, as well as lifestyle factors such as smoking, excessive alcohol consumption, and drug use, can negatively affect sperm production and quality.
Treatment for low sperm count depends on the underlying cause and may involve a combination of medical, lifestyle, and surgical interventions. Addressing hormonal imbalances or treating underlying medical conditions with medication can improve sperm production. Lifestyle modifications, such as improving diet, increasing physical activity, reducing stress, and avoiding harmful substances, can also enhance sperm count and overall reproductive health. In cases where varicoceles are identified, surgical correction may be recommended to improve sperm count. For individuals with genetic issues or severe oligospermia, assisted reproductive technologies (ART), such as in vitro fertilization (IVF) or intracytoplasmic sperm injection (ICSI), may be utilized to facilitate conception. Regular follow-ups with a healthcare provider, including a urologist or fertility specialist, are important for monitoring treatment progress and making necessary adjustments. Early intervention and a comprehensive approach to managing the contributing factors are crucial for improving sperm count and increasing the chances of successful conception.
